如何使用AI语音开放平台开发语音播报功能

随着人工智能技术的飞速发展,越来越多的企业和开发者开始关注AI语音开放平台,希望通过这个平台将语音技术应用于实际项目中。本文将讲述一位开发者如何使用AI语音开放平台开发语音播报功能的故事,以期为读者提供一些参考。

故事的主人公是一位年轻的创业者,名叫李明。李明一直对人工智能技术充满热情,他希望通过自己的努力,将AI语音技术应用到日常生活中,让更多的人享受到科技带来的便捷。在一次偶然的机会,他了解到一个名为“语音宝”的AI语音开放平台,于是决定尝试使用该平台开发一款语音播报应用。

一、了解AI语音开放平台

在开始开发之前,李明首先对“语音宝”AI语音开放平台进行了深入了解。他发现,该平台提供了丰富的语音功能,包括语音识别、语音合成、语音唤醒等,同时还支持多种语言和方言。此外,平台还提供了详细的API文档和示例代码,方便开发者快速上手。

二、确定应用场景

在了解了AI语音开放平台的基本功能后,李明开始思考自己的应用场景。经过一番思考,他决定开发一款语音播报应用,可以将新闻、天气预报、股市行情等内容以语音形式播报给用户。

三、注册账号并创建项目

接下来,李明在“语音宝”平台上注册了账号,并创建了一个新的项目。在创建项目时,他需要填写项目名称、描述、开发语言等信息。同时,还需要选择合适的语音合成模型,以便生成高质量的语音播报。

四、开发语音播报功能

在项目创建完成后,李明开始着手开发语音播报功能。以下是开发过程中的一些关键步骤:

  1. 获取API密钥

为了使用“语音宝”平台的语音合成功能,李明需要获取一个API密钥。在平台官网,他找到了“开发者中心”页面,并按照提示成功获取了API密钥。


  1. 引入SDK

根据API文档,李明将“语音宝”平台的SDK引入到自己的项目中。SDK提供了丰富的API接口,方便开发者调用。


  1. 调用语音合成API

在项目中,李明通过调用语音合成API,将文本内容转换为语音。为了实现实时播报,他使用了WebSocket技术,实现了与语音合成服务器的实时通信。


  1. 播报效果优化

为了提高语音播报的音质和流畅度,李明对播报效果进行了优化。他尝试了不同的语音合成模型,并调整了语速、音调等参数,最终达到了满意的效果。

五、测试与上线

在完成语音播报功能的开发后,李明对应用进行了全面测试。他邀请了多位用户进行试用,收集反馈意见,并对应用进行优化。经过多次迭代,应用终于上线。

六、收获与感悟

通过使用AI语音开放平台开发语音播报功能,李明不仅成功地将AI语音技术应用于实际项目中,还积累了丰富的开发经验。以下是他的收获与感悟:

  1. AI语音开放平台为开发者提供了便捷的开发工具和丰富的资源,降低了开发门槛。

  2. 在开发过程中,要注重用户体验,不断优化产品功能和性能。

  3. 团队合作至关重要,与团队成员保持良好的沟通,共同推进项目进展。

  4. 保持对新技术的好奇心,不断学习,才能在AI领域取得更好的成绩。

总之,使用AI语音开放平台开发语音播报功能是一项具有挑战性的任务,但只要用心去开发,就能创造出有价值的产品。希望本文能够为更多开发者提供参考,共同推动AI语音技术的发展。

猜你喜欢:人工智能对话